Review of Related Literature


and Studies

Here are some related past studies that the researchers


conducted same as my survey report I am working on;

According to Junco al et (2010), social media are a


collection of internet websites, services, and practices
that support collaboration, community building,
participation, and sharing”. The growing dimension of
the use of social media among the youth of today
cannot be over emphasized. Over the years, social
networking among second cycle students has become
more and more popular. It is a way to make connection
not only on campus, but with friends outside of school.
Social networking is a way that helps many people feels
as though they belong to a community. Due to the
increased popularity of it, economists and professors are
questioning whether grades of students are not being
affected by how much time is spend on these sites
(Choney, 2010).

Many researchers such as Choney (2010), San Miguel


(2009) and Enriquez (2010) studies on students’ use of
the social media sites revealed a negative effect of the
use of social media sites on students’ academic
performance. Nielsen Media Research study conducted
in June 2010 stated that almost 25% of students’ time on
the internet is spent on social networking sites
(Jacobsen & Forste 2011).The American Educational
Research Association conducted a research and
declared at its annual conference in San Diego
California (2009), that social media users study less and
generate lower grade (Abaleta et al, 2014).

Analysis and Discussion


The growth of the internet and its increasing influence,


which now dominates users' lives, prompted researchers
to investigate the potential effects of regular internet
use on both young people's and adults' physical and
mental development. The exposure of users to
propaganda and racist beliefs is one of the many
factors that make up this novel and ever-changing
environment. Internet content that promotes suicide as a
remedy may also be inappropriate and deceptive.
Online gambling and other types of gambling available
to users through the Internet may contribute to internet
addiction. The risk of exposure to the online world
through social networks is greatest for younger users, as
new phenomena like online seduction, cyber bullying,
cheating by hidden advertising messages, etc. have a
significant negative impact on their psychological and
emotional growth and frequently permanently
stigmatize them. Additionally, the growth and
dissemination of the Internet changed and modernized
how a fraud is defined. As soon as people started using
plastic money for only online transactions, examples of
money extortion through fraud, identity theft, and misuse
of user data started to emerge. Although scams have
always existed, the elimination of interpersonal contact
and physical constraints gave them a chance to expand.

There are a few behaviors that can help us use social


media more deliberately so that we can concentrate on
the positive and avoid the frequent pitfalls, here are
some recommendations:

(1) Spend less time on social platforms.


One study found that reducing social media use to a
maximum of a half hour a day led to a decrease in
feelings of anxiety, depression, and loneliness.

(2) Don’t scroll first thing in the morning or before bed.


While many of us use wake-up alarms on our devices
(making it all too easy to reach for our phones in bed), a
constant stream of news, updates, and selfies doesn’t
typically set the best conditions for winding down or
gearing up to start the day. Consider establishing more
mindful routines around these 2 daily constants. Screen-
free activities like journaling, practicing gratitude, and
meditation are great places to start.

20

(3) Create a feel-good follow list.


If the worry is that social media use is contributing to
negative feelings, we audit our follow list. Unfollow the
accounts that might be leading to the negative feelings
we’ve mentioned, and instead follow accounts that
make us feel good, provide entertainment, or even help
motivate us to reach your goals.
